The role of lead users in knowledge sharing

open access: yesResearch Policy, 2009
This paper introduces a model of knowledge sharing in an online community of practice that suggests that knowledge contributions will be made by those who possess the relevant knowledge. For them, matching a ready-made solution to a problem is low cost.

Embedded lead users—The benefits of employing users for corporate innovation

open access: yesResearch Policy, 2015
While most of the literature views users and producers as organizationally distinct, this paper studies users within producer firms. We define "embedded lead users" (ELUs) as employees who are lead users of their employing firm's products or services.
